Each quarterly issue of the Journal of Rural Health combines all you need to know in one accessible place. The journal is dedicated to bringing you the most up-to-date rural health research, policy discussion and education information. Its principal goal is to advance professional practice, research, theory development, and public policy related to rural health. Each issue features original research, policy assessment and educational topics to allow rural health professionals to continue to grow in their field.
